Adenosine 5′-Triphosphate Disodium (ATP-Na2) — Anhydrous vs Trihydrate

Specifications & Technical Parameters

Item ATP Disodium Anhydrous ATP Disodium Trihydrate (Mainstream Pharma Grade)
Standard CAS No. 987-65-5 51963-61-2
Full Chemical Name Adenosine 5′-triphosphate disodium salt anhydrous Adenosine 5′-triphosphate disodium salt trihydrate
Molecular Formula C₁₀H₁₄N₅Na₂O₁₃P₃ C₁₀H₂₀N₅Na₂O₁₆P₃
Molecular Weight 551.15 605.19
EINECS Number 213-579-1 Matched trihydrate registry
Appearance White crystalline powder, strong moisture absorption White crystal powder, milder hygroscopicity than anhydrous
Solubility Easily soluble in pure water; insoluble in ethanol, ether, acetone Same water solubility, better long-term powder stability
1% Aqueous pH 3.6–5.8 4.0–6.0
Decomposition Temp 176–188℃ 178–190℃

Critical Differences: Anhydrous vs. Trihydrate

  • Stability & Logistics: Trihydrate contains crystal water, making it less prone to rapid hydrolysis during long-distance sea transportation. Anhydrous ATP easily absorbs ambient water vapor to form hydrates; it is only suitable for short-term lab use under strict -20℃ sealed storage.
  • Dosage Calculation: When preparing molar standard liquids, the molecular weight must be clearly distinguished. 100g of Anhydrous ATP equals approximately 109.8g of Trihydrate in pure ATP effective content. This difference is critical for accurate pharmaceutical formulation dosage calculation.
  • Application Matching: Trihydrate is ideal for mass pharmaceutical production and bulk commercial export, whereas Anhydrous is reserved for high-precision lab biochemical testing and academic research kits.

Grade Classification & Purity Standards

1
Pharmaceutical Injection Grade

Trihydrate Dominant: HPLC purity ≥98.0%; ADP ≤1.8%, AMP ≤0.9%, free adenosine ≤0.4%; bacterial endotoxin <0.5EU/mg; heavy metals ≤10ppm. Complies fully with CP pharmacopoeia standards. Primarily used as raw material for ATP injections & oral tablets.

2
Biochemical Research Grade

Anhydrous Preferred: HPLC purity ≥99.0%; DNase/RNase/protease free; ultra-low endotoxin. Perfect for cell culture, enzyme activity assays, P2 receptor research, and high-precision laboratory standard solution preparation.

3
Food & Nutraceutical Grade

Trihydrate: HPLC purity ≥97.0%; microbial limits strictly meet global food raw material standards. Widely used for anti-fatigue sports supplements and bulk nutrition powders.

Main Industrial Application Scenarios

1. Pharmaceutical Active Ingredients (API):

Used in ATP injections, ATP enteric-coated tablets, and compound energy mixture APIs for myocardial injury, nerve rehabilitation, and auxiliary treatment of chronic hepatitis.

2. In Vitro Diagnostic (IVD) Reagents:

Serves as a vital substrate for ATP bioluminescence microbial detection kits and kinase activity testing assays.

3. Biotech & Laboratory Supplies:

Utilized as a mammalian cell culture medium additive and an essential intracellular energy metabolism research reagent.

4. Health & Sports Supplements:

Acts as a premium raw material for endurance sports nutrition powders and anti-fatigue oral functional foods.

Q4
How should ATP disodium powder be stored to avoid rapid degradation?

  • Trihydrate ATP powder: Must be kept sealed, shaded from light, and stored at 2–8℃.
  • Anhydrous ATP powder: Must be vacuum-sealed and strictly kept at -20℃.
  • Aqueous solutions: ATP solutions will hydrolyze within just 3 hours at room temperature. Always prepare liquid reagents immediately before use, and freeze any surplus liquid at -70℃ for long-term preservation.

Q7
Can anhydrous ATP disodium replace trihydrate in pharmaceutical formulations?

This is not recommended for mass commercial production. Anhydrous ATP absorbs environmental moisture rapidly during production mixing, which can lead to an unstable active ingredient dosage concentration. If forced substitution is absolutely required, you must recalculate the feeding weight based on the molecular weight difference and strictly maintain workshop relative humidity below 30%.

2. Key Chemical & Stability Differences Between ATP Disodium Anhydrous and Trihydrate

The most fundamental gap separating the two ATP disodium variants lies in crystal water content, which completely reshapes molecular weight, storage stability, and industrial applicability.

Technical Metrics ATP Disodium Trihydrate ATP Disodium Anhydrous
Official CAS Registry 51963-61-2 987-65-5
Molecular Weight 605.19 (Fixed structure) 551.15 (Higher initial active content)
Hygroscopicity Risk Mild & Stable; locks water structure Extreme; triggers hydration within 10 mins
Logistics Profile Excellent for long-distance ocean shipping Prone to hydrolysis into ADP/AMP if exposed
Primary Environment Mass pharmaceutical mixing workshops Strictly low-humidity lab settings

5. Standard Storage & Handling Protocols to Extend ATP Disodium Shelf Life

Improper storage is the leading cause of chemical degradation reported by global buyers. Storage rules differ strictly by hydration state:

• Trihydrate ATP Disodium Powder: Keep original vacuum packaging sealed, store in a cool, dry warehouse at 2–8℃, and keep away from sunlight. Unopened drums maintain a 24-month shelf life. Once opened, finish the batch within 90 days or reseal using a nitrogen purge.
• Anhydrous ATP Disodium Powder: Must be kept at a constant temperature of -20℃ with double vacuum aluminum foil packaging. Short-term transportation without a cold chain must not exceed 7 days to avoid weight gain from hydration.
• Crucial Solution Rule: Aqueous ATP solution prepared from either variant cannot sit at room temperature; it hydrolyzes within 3 hours. Working buffers should be prepared fresh daily. Split any surplus liquid into micro-tubes and store at -70℃ for a maximum of 3 months.
